使用 EPPlus 库可以方便地生成 Excel 文件,并保存到本地。以下是一个示例代码,演示了如何使用 EPPlus 生成一个包含数据的 Excel 文件,并保存到指定路径。

using OfficeOpenXml;

class Program
{
    static void Main(string[] args)
    {
        // 创建一个 ExcelPackage 对象
        using (var excelPackage = new ExcelPackage())
        {
            // 添加一个工作表
            var worksheet = excelPackage.Workbook.Worksheets.Add('Sheet1');

            // 在工作表中写入数据
            worksheet.Cells['A1'].Value = 'Name';
            worksheet.Cells['B1'].Value = 'Age';
            worksheet.Cells['A2'].Value = 'John';
            worksheet.Cells['B2'].Value = 25;

            // 保存 Excel 文件
            var filePath = 'C:\path\to\save\file.xlsx';
            excelPackage.SaveAs(new System.IO.FileInfo(filePath));
        }
    }
}

在上述代码中,首先创建了一个 ExcelPackage 对象。然后,通过 Workbook.Worksheets.Add 方法添加了一个工作表。在工作表中,使用 Cells 属性和 Value 属性可以写入数据。最后,使用 SaveAs 方法将 Excel 文件保存到指定路径。

需要注意的是,在使用 EPPlus 之前,需要确保已经安装了 EPPlus 包,并将其添加为项目的引用。

.NET 6 使用 EPPlus 生成 Excel 并保存:详细步骤和代码示例

原文地址: https://www.cveoy.top/t/topic/qlzF 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录